Mother House or Missionaries of Charity is the erstwhile residence of one of the most iconic women in Indian history-Mother Teresa. It was established by Mother Teresa in 1950 with the purpose of selfless service to mankind and to uplift the plagued humanity towards the path of salvation. She lived and worked in this home from 1953 till 1997 when she breathed her last. This is the headquarters of the international religious congregation of the Missionaries of Charity known as Saint Teresa of Kolkata. CLOSED ON THURSDAY

You will visit the Mullik Ghat Flower Market, where you can experience the vibrant colors and fragrances of countless flowers. This is one of the largest flower markets in Asia and a photographer's delight.
